The light is for the lambda sensor after/in the cat.

The fault code is to tell you CO2 below threshold or something like that, to say the cat is not working correctly (not sure what the actual code number is)

The car will run fine with it on, don't worry about that. As for turning it off not a clue mate. The code will more than likely be P0420 cat efficiency or summit like that , basically the ford ECU isn't seeing the numbers it should be from the standard cat (which is huge) - had the same on my ST with a 100 cell cat I just lived with it .

Wouldn't keep pulling KAM fuse to trick the car into thinking it's ok , get a sensor spacer as above and try that , failing that a good remap on the car will put the light out as staffy owner said it will be optimised for any performance mods .
